The Best All-Around Complete SkateboardsFor riders who want a high-quality setup straight out of the box, complete skateboards offer convenience without sacrificing performance. Brands like Element, Santa Cruz, and Powell-Peralta continue to dominate the market with top-rated completes that cater to both beginners and seasoned skaters. A premium complete skateboard typically features a seven-ply maple deck, durable aluminum trucks, and versatile wheels suitable for both park and street skating. Look for setups with medium-concave decks, which provide an excellent balance of stability and flip-trick responsiveness. These all-around boards ensure you can transition seamlessly from cruising local bike paths to practicing technical tricks at the local skatepark as the spring weather heats up.
Top-Rated Street Skating DecksStreet skating demands equipment that can withstand high impacts, repetitive slides, and heavy friction. This spring, technical street skaters are gravitating toward innovative deck constructions that offer enhanced durability and pop. Real Skateboards and Girl Skateboards remain highly rated for their classic shapes and dependable wood quality. Meanwhile, technologically advanced options, such as decks reinforced with fiberglass or carbon fiber inserts, are gaining massive popularity. These specialized constructions prevent the board from becoming soggy over time, ensuring that your pop stays crisp throughout the entire season. Pairing these decks with smaller, harder wheels allows for better technical control on concrete ledges, rails, and stairs.
Transition and Bowl Riding FavoritesIf your idea of a perfect spring afternoon involves carving concrete bowls, flying out of vert ramps, or cruising pump tracks, you need a setup tailored for transition riding. Transition skateboards generally feature wider decks, often ranging from 8.5 inches to 9 inches or more, providing a stable platform for high-speed carves. Antihero and Creature are highly rated brands known for producing rugged, wider decks that excel in deep bowls. To optimize a transition setup for spring sessioning, pair the wider deck with larger, slightly softer wheels. This combination maintains speed across rougher park surfaces and delivers maximum grip when carving high on the pool coping.
Cruisers and Longboards for Spring CommutesSpring is the prime season for swapping vehicular commutes for sidewalk cruising. Cruiser skateboards and longboards are top-rated for transportation because they emphasize comfort, stability, and smooth rolling over rough terrain. Brands like Landyachtz and Sector 9 offer exceptionally rated cruiser models that feature compact shapes, functional kicktails, and large, soft polyurethane wheels. These wheels easily roll over pebbles, sidewalk cracks, and spring debris that would stop a standard street skateboard in its tracks. Whether you are commuting to campus, running errands, or simply enjoying a sunset cruise, a high-quality cruiser delivers a effortless and enjoyable riding experience.
Essential Component UpgradesSometimes, the best way to prepare for spring skating is not buying an entirely new board, but upgrading specific components of your current ride. Upgrading to top-rated trucks from Independent, Thunder, or Venture can dramatically alter how your skateboard turns and grinds. Additionally, swapping out old, sluggish bearings for a fresh set of Bones Reds or Bronson Speed Co. bearings will instantly restore your board’s speed and efficiency. Do not overlook your griptape either; replacing a worn-out, muddy sheet with fresh, gritty tape from Mob or Jessup will give your feet the secure connection needed to execute tricks safely and confidently during your seasonal progression.
